I use very simple strategy. EMA 20 & EMA 200 Sometimes I put the EMA 9 because those work well with the MACD. Use the 5/15 min charts. There must be 2 to 3 times avg volume for the long and 2 to 3 time less avg volume to short. Shorts work really well after hours and weekends from my experience. Buy when the MACD & Signal cross zero upward with heavy volume. Sell when the first MACD candle drops approx 20% below the previous candle and when the 20 EMA crosses below the a red candle. Practice this tactic. Or just practice with this set up and when you have some reasonable profit, get out. Do stay in too long.
